Po delsimo pagaliau pasirodo nauja Mesa 22.2 tvarkyklių versija

Vairuotojų stalas

„Mesa“ yra atvirojo kodo sukurta grafikos biblioteka, teikianti bendrą OpenGL įgyvendinimą.

Po kelių savaičių vėlavimo (ir keturių mėnesių kūrimo nuo paskutinio išleidimo) paleidimas nauja OpenGL ir Vulkan API diegimo versija "22.2.0 lentelė", tai yra pirmoji Mesa 22.2.x šakos versija kuri turi eksperimentinį statusą ir kad po galutinio kodo stabilizavimo bus išleista stabili Mesa 22.2.1 versija.

Ir tai Mesa 22.2.0 turėjo pasirodyti rugpjūčio pabaigoje arba rugsėjo pradžioje (tačiau tai buvo šiek tiek daugiau nei 2 savaitės), nes Mesa 22.2-rc3 buvo išleistas rugpjūčio 19 d., o tada galutiniai 22.2 savaitės išleidimo kandidatai tiesiog neįvyko, todėl galutinis leidimas buvo išleistas šiomis dienomis.

22.2 lentelė. Pagrindinės naujovės

Šioje naujoje versijoje, kurią pristatė Mesa 22.2, grafikos API palaikymas „Vulkan 1.3“ galima įsigyti adresu anv, skirtas GPU Intel, radv AMD GPU ir Qualcomm GPU. „Vulkan 1.2“ palaikoma emuliatoriaus režimu (vn), „Vulkan 1.1“ – „lavapipe“ programinės įrangos rasterizatoriuje (lvp) ir „Vulkan 1.0“ v3dv tvarkyklėje (Raspberry Pi 4 Broadcom VideoCore VI GPU).

Be to, Qualcomm (tu) GPU tvarkyklė palaiko Vulkan 1.3 grafikos API, taip pat Mali GPU palaikymas, pagrįstas Valhall mikroarchitektūra (Mali-G57), buvo pridėtas prie Panfrost tvarkyklės (tvarkyklė yra suderinama su OpenGL ES 3.1 specifikacija).

Kiti pakeitimai, kurie išsiskiria šioje naujoje „Mesa 22.2“ versijoje, yra patobulintas Intel DG2-G12 vaizdo plokščių palaikymas (Arc Alchemist) ANV Vulkan tvarkyklėje (Intel) ir Iris OpenGL tvarkyklėje, taip pat Vulkan tvarkyklė žymiai (apie 100 kartų) pagerino spindulių sekimo kodo veikimą.

R600g valdiklis skirtas nuo AMD Radeon HD 2000 iki HD 6000 serijos GPU perkelta naudoti tarpinį atvaizdavimą (IR) nėra šešėlių tipo NIR. NIR palaikymas taip pat įgalina „Tungsten Graphics Shader Infrastructure“ (TGSI) atvaizdavimo palaikymą, įgalindamas sluoksnį NIR paversti TGSI.

Iš kitų pokyčių kurie išsiskiria iš šios naujos versijos:

  • Tęsiamas „Vulkan“ tvarkyklės, skirtos GPU, diegimas, pagrįstas „Imagination“ sukurta „PowerVR Rogue“ architektūra.
  • „Nouveau OpenGL“ tvarkyklė pradėjo diegti RTX 30 „Ampere“ GPU palaikymą.
  • Vivante kortelių Etnaviv tvarkyklėje įdiegtas asinchroninio šešėlių kompiliavimo palaikymas.
  • „Mesa“ kompiliavimo palaikymas išjungus pasirinktus vaizdo kodekus dėl programinės įrangos patento problemų.
  • „Lavapipe“ tvarkyklė, kaip „Vulkan“ programinės įrangos diegimas, papildė naujų plėtinių, tokių kaip VK_EXT_robustness2, ir kintamųjų rodyklės palaikymą.
  • Se agregó soporte para las extensiones de Vulkan, VK_EXT_robustness2 para controlador de lavapipe, VK_EXT_image_2d_view_of_3d para RADV, VK_EXT_primitives_generated_query para RADV, VK_EXT_non_seamless_cube_map para RADV, ANV, lavapipe, VK_EXT_border_color_swizzle para lavapipe, ANV, nabo, RADV, VK_EXT_shader_module_identifier para RADV, VK_EXT_multisampled_render_to_single_sampled para lavapipe, VK_EXT_shader_subgroup_vote lavapipe, VK_EXT_shader_subgroup_ballot for lavapipe ir VK_EXT_attachment_feedback_loop_layout RADV.

Pagaliau jei norite sužinoti daugiau apie tai apie šią naują Mesa tvarkyklių versiją galite patikrinti išsami informacija šioje nuorodoje.

Kaip įdiegti „Mesa“ vaizdo tvarkykles į „Linux“?

Mesa paketai rasti visuose „Linux“ platinimuose, todėl jį įdiegti galima atsisiųsti ir sukompiliuoti šaltinio kodą (Visa informacija apie tai čia) arba palyginti paprastai, o tai priklauso nuo jūsų platinimo ar trečiųjų šalių galimybės oficialiuose kanaluose.

Tiems, kurie naudoja „Ubuntu“, „Linux Mint“ ir darinius jie gali pridėti šią saugyklą, kurioje tvarkyklės greitai atnaujinamos.

sudo add-apt-repository ppa:kisak/kisak-mesa -y

Dabar mes atnaujinsime savo paketų ir saugyklų sąrašą:

sudo apt update

Galiausiai mes galime įdiegti tvarkykles:

sudo apt upgrade

Tiems, kurie yra Arch archyvuokite „Linux“ vartotojus ir jų darinius, mes juos įdiegiame naudodami šią komandą:

sudo pacman -S mesa mesa-demos mesa-libgl lib32-mesa lib32-mesa-libgl

Kad ir kokie jie būtų „Fedora 32“ vartotojai gali naudoti šią saugyklą, todėl jie turi įgalinti „Corp“ su:

sudo dnf copr enable grigorig/mesa-stable

sudo dnf update

Galiausiai, tiems, kurie yra „openSUSE“ vartotojai, jie gali įdiegti arba atnaujinti įvesdami:

sudo zypper in mesa

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Už duomenis atsakingas: AB Internet Networks 2008 SL
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.